SQL представляет собой инструмент организованных запросов для контроля информацией в реляционных базах данных. Инструмент позволяет генерировать таблицы, включать записи, модифицировать данные и удалять ненужную сведения. SQL применяют разработчики, аналитики, управляющие баз данных и тестировщики.
Средство функционирует через команды, которые посылаются системе управления базами данных. Команды фиксируются текстом по заданным правилам синтаксиса. Система получает запрос, выполняет запрос и отдаёт результат.
Деятельность с SQL стартует с освоения ключевых инструкций для отбора и корректировки сведений. Начинающие постигают инструкции SELECT, INSERT, UPDATE и DELETE. Практика взаимодействия с admiral x помогает закрепить знания и постичь логику создания команд.
SQL отличается декларативным способом к программированию. Пользователь обозначает нужный итог, а система автономно определяет способ реализации операции. Такой метод облегчает создание запросов для новичков профессионалов.
SQL задействуется для содержания и обработки структурированной сведений в коммерческих и общественных проектах. Язык гарантирует мгновенный подключение к миллионам строк и позволяет реализовывать исследовательские операции над данными.
Интернет-магазины задействуют SQL для администрирования перечнями продуктов, обработки покупок и контроля запасов. Банковские системы сохраняют сведения о потребителях, переводах и счетах в реляционных базах. Социальные сети задействуют язык для взаимодействия с аккаунтами пользователей и публикациями.
Аналитики admiral x получают информацию из баз для создания отчётов и нахождения зависимостей. SQL обеспечивает возможность агрегировать метрики, вычислять усреднённые параметры и группировать информацию по параметрам. Маркетологи изучают поведение заказчиков с помощью запросов к базам данных.
Разработчики формируют сервисы, которые коммуницируют с базами через SQL. Интернет-сервисы направляют инструкции для извлечения данных и показа материала. Портативные сервисы синхронизируют сведения с серверами.
База данных является собой организованное репозиторий информации, состоящее из соединённых таблиц. Каждая таблица содержит данные об установленной сущности: потребителях, товарах, заказах или переводах. Структура базы создаётся с учётом деловых требований и нюансов предметной отрасли.
Таблица складывается из строк и полей, повторяя компьютерную таблицу. Столбцы задают атрибуты объектов и называются полями. Строки хранят специфические записи с сведениями об индивидуальных элементах объекта. Каждое поле содержит определённый тип данных: числовой, строковый, дата или двоичный.
Основной ключ безошибочно определяет каждую элемент в таблице. Типично главным ключом становится числовое поле с неповторимыми параметрами. Связующие ключи устанавливают соединения между таблицами и поддерживают согласованность данных в базе.
Ключевые части архитектуры таблицы содержат:
Нормализация базы данных исключает копирование данных и распределяет данные по тематическим таблицам. Процедура нормализации следует конкретным стандартам, обозначаемым нормальными формами. Правильная структура адмирал х облегчает обслуживание и увеличивает эффективность системы.
Модель базы данных графически показывает таблицы и отношения между ними. Диаграммы содействуют уяснить структуру построения данных и построить эффективную архитектуру. Взаимодействие с admiral x требует знания правил организации реляционных схем данных.
SELECT получает сведения из таблиц базы данных. Команда обеспечивает возможность определить нужные колонки и критерии выборки записей. Команда возвращает итог в виде совокупности записей, соответствующих требованиям команды.
INSERT добавляет новые записи в таблицу. Команда нуждается обозначения наименования таблицы и величин для внесения полей. Можно добавить одну строку или множество строк за одну команду. Система проверяет соответствие информации типам полей перед вставкой.
UPDATE корректирует существующие записи в таблице. Команда обеспечивает возможность скорректировать значения единственного или ряда полей. Условие WHERE устанавливает, какие записи требуют изменению. Без обозначения параметра оператор скорректирует все строки в таблице.
DELETE убирает элементы из таблицы по заданному критерию. Инструкция необратимо удаляет данные, поэтому нуждается аккуратного применения. Критерий WHERE определяет, какие записи требуется удалить.
CREATE TABLE формирует дополнительную таблицу с определённой организацией полей. Оператор устанавливает наименования столбцов, виды данных и условия. DROP TABLE полностью уничтожает таблицу вместе со всем наполнением. Освоение admiral-x создаёт базовые компетенции управления данными в реляционных механизмах хранения.
Параметр WHERE отбирает строки по указанным критериям. Инструкция обеспечивает возможность отобрать строки, отвечающие установленным значениям полей. Можно задействовать инструкции сравнения и булевы команды AND, OR, NOT для составления составных условий. Выборка уменьшает массив получаемых информации.
ORDER BY сортирует результаты извлечения по одному или ряду полям. Инструкция допускает упорядочивание по увеличению и уменьшению параметров. Организация строк делает проще исследование данных и поиск необходимых параметров.
GROUP BY консолидирует элементы с идентичными значениями в указанных столбцах. Консолидация используется вместе с агрегатными функциями для определения совокупных метрик. Методы COUNT, SUM, AVG, MIN и MAX вычисляют количество записей, итоги, усреднённые величины, наименьшие значения и наибольшие значения.
HAVING отбирает результаты после группировки данных. Критерий используется к объединённым значениям и обеспечивает возможность извлечь совокупности, отвечающие заданным условиям по вычисленным величинам.
Команды LIKE и IN увеличивают способности отбора данных. LIKE реализует нахождение по образцу с заменяемыми знаками. IN проверяет наличие значения в список альтернатив. Верное применение адмирал х улучшает эффективность статистических запросов.
JOIN связывает строки из множества таблиц на основании отношений между ними. Команда даёт возможность получить информацию, размещённую по отличающимся таблицам, в единственном результирующем наборе. Соединение формируется через общие поля, как правило основной и вторичный ключи.
INNER JOIN возвращает только те записи, для которых выявлены совпадения в двух таблицах. Элементы без соответствия отбрасываются из итога. Данный вид связывания используется, когда требуются данные, находящиеся одновременно в соединённых таблицах.
LEFT JOIN включает все записи из левой таблицы и совпадающие элементы из правой. Если пересечение отсутствует, столбцы правой таблицы наполняются величинами NULL. Оператор задействуется для извлечения исчерпывающего списка строк из основной таблицы.
RIGHT JOIN действует противоположным способом, сохраняя все строки правой таблицы. FULL OUTER JOIN выдаёт все элементы из двух таблиц, наполняя недостающие величины NULL.
CROSS JOIN формирует декартово комбинацию таблиц, объединяя каждую строку первой таблицы с каждой строкой второй. Вложенные запросы дают возможность применять итог одного инструкции внутри другого. Изучение admiral x и осознание механизмов объединения таблиц расширяет способности работы с admiral-x в многотабличных базах данных.
Построение сводок составляет значительную часть работы с базами данных. Аналитики извлекают информацию о продажах, потребителях и финансовых показателях за установленные интервалы. Запросы агрегируют сведения и классифицируют результаты по категориям для предоставления руководству.
Поиск дубликатов помогает сохранять качество данных в системе. Инструкции находят дублирующиеся строки по основным колонкам: email, телефон или идентификационный номер. Нахождение дублей даёт возможность упорядочить базу и предотвратить ошибки.
Миграция информации между платформами предполагает выгрузки сведений из единственной базы и загрузки в иную. SQL гарантирует выгрузку строк в нужном виде и загрузку информации с трансформацией структуры.
Вычисление аналитических показателей реализуется через суммирующие операции и объединение информации. Профессионалы определяют средний платёж клиента, конверсию воронки продаж и изменение расширения пользовательской базы.
Контроль полномочиями доступа сужает возможности участников по деятельности с сведениями. Операторы определяют права на чтение, корректировку и стирание сведений для отличающихся позиций. Прикладное применение адмирал х включает широкий набор проблем от аналитики до администрирования платформ.
Отсутствие критерия WHERE при модификации или устранении строк влечёт к модификации всех строк в таблице. Новички упускают задать критерий выборки и случайно изменяют данные, которые призваны остаться неизменными. Перед исполнением инструкций UPDATE и DELETE требуется проконтролировать критерий фильтрации.
Пренебрежение индексов замедляет исполнение команд к крупным таблицам. Обнаружение без индексов вынуждает систему сканировать все элементы поочерёдно. Создание индексов для часто задействуемых колонок ускоряет операции выборки сведений в десятки раз.
Типичные ошибки неопытных специалистов охватывают:
Ошибочное применение форматов данных ведёт к избыточному использованию дискового места. Выбор строкового поля значительного размера для хранения коротких значений неэффективен. Каждый формат данных обладает оптимальную область задействования и правила.
Пренебрежение транзакциями при выполнении взаимосвязанных команд разрушает непротиворечивость сведений. Если одна из операторов заканчивается ошибкой, ранние модификации остаются в базе. Транзакции предоставляют целостность реализации группы команд.
Дублирование команд без знания логики функционирования порождает трудности при модификации скрипта. Изучение admiral-x нуждается сознательного метода и анализа данных выполнения инструкций.